Exploring the Wonders of Sustainable Safari in South Africa

Adventure seekers and nature lovers, rejoice! If you’re planning a getaway that combines wildlife, conservation, and breathtaking scenery, a game drive through the Soutpansberg Mountains in South Africa offers a truly unforgettable experience.

Recently, our journey led us past some of the magnificent baobab trees that dot the landscape. These ancient giants tell stories of times long past, their rugged bark marked by the history of the region. Our knowledgeable guide, Muzwandir Ntloko, highlighted the deep scars on the trees as marks left by elephants that roamed these lands nearly a century ago. While these majestic creatures might be absent for now, conservation efforts are afoot! Restoration projects aim to not only revitalize grasslands but also to help other apex species like lions reclaim their place in this rich ecosystem.

During our game drive, the thriving wildlife caught our eyes. We spotted graceful giraffes munching on acacia leaves, playful zebras frolicking in groups, and the elusive kudu peering curiously through the underbrush. The area is also home to hippos basking in the sun, waterbucks grazing, and a stunning array of rare birds and butterflies that add vibrant splashes of color to the canvas of nature. The energy of the landscape is palpable, proving that the wilderness is indeed alive and flourishing.

On my final morning at the lodge, I eagerly ventured out to hike the Sengi Trail—one of many routes inspired by natural wildlife paths. Dawn Buyens, the lodge’s conservation manager and lead ecologist, warmly stated, “The baboons love this path; they are part of the maintenance crew.” With that, our journey became not just an outdoor exploration but also a lesson in sustainable living. Our local guide, Moses, who is also a traditional healer, shared insights about medicinal plants along the way. We discovered the wondrous properties of Spekboom, a hardy succulent known for its natural preservation qualities.

With every step of our hike, the symbiotic relationship between humans and nature shone brightly.
